SPRINT CUP PREVIEW RACE NO. 24: BRISTOL After the Daytona 500 and Allstate 400 at the Brickyard, NASCAR racing doesn't get much more electric than the annual summer race at Bristol. The Sharpie 500 is short-track racing at its best: three hours of banging and crashing and drivers looking to get even under the lights. Despite an enormous seating capacity of 160,000, Bristol has sold out 53 consecutive times for its Sprint Cup races, easily the longest streak in the sport.
